Full Job Description
We want to build agents that autonomously validate code changes. Today that looks like AI that reviews pull requests in GitHub, catching bugs and enforcing standards. We're reviewing close to 1B lines of code a month now for over 3,000 companies.

Problems we're excited about
  • Coding standards can be idiosyncratic and are often poorly documented; can we build agents that learn them through osmosis like a new hire might?
  • Can we identify for each customer what types of PR feedback they do and don't care about, perhaps using some sample efficient RL, in order to increase signal-to-noise ratio?
  • Some bugs are best caught by running the code, potentially against discerning AI-generated E2E tests. Can we autonomously deploy feature branches and use agents to parallel try to break the application to detect bugs?
